Simplifying [x + -2] = 7 Reorder the terms: [-2 + x] = 7 Remove brackets around [-2 + x] -2 + x = 7 Solving -2 + x = 7 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'2' to each side of the equation. -2 + 2 + x = 7 + 2 Combine like terms: -2 + 2 = 0 0 + x = 7 + 2 x = 7 + 2 Combine like terms: 7 + 2 = 9 x = 9 Simplifying x = 9
